What is SCHD?
The Schwab U.S. Dividend Equity ETF is developed to track the efficiency of the Dow Jones U.S. Dividend 100 Index. This index represents high dividend yielding U.S. stocks that have a record of consistently paying dividends. schd dividend value calculator is favored for its combination of both income from dividends and capital growth potential, making it appealing for a large array of financiers.

A Dividend Total Return Calculator is a tool that enables financiers to estimate prospective returns from their financial investments. For SCHD, the calculator takes into account:
Initial Investment: The quantity of cash purchased the ETF.Dividend Reinvestment: Whether dividends are reinvested to purchase additional shares.Holding Period: The length of time the investment is held.Growth Rate: Expected annual growth in dividend payments.
By inputting these variables, investors receive an estimated total return over their picked time frame, assisting them make more educated financial choices.

The Importance of Dividend Reinvestment
Dividends can be reinvested to purchase extra shares, which can tremendously increase total returns with time due to the power of substance interest. The reinvestment technique is one of the most efficient ways to build up wealth, particularly in dividend-paying stocks like SCHD.

Here's a detailed guide for those brand-new to utilizing dividend total return calculators:

Access the Calculator: Several sites use dividend calculators particularly for SCHD. It is vital to select one that is user-friendly and reliable.

Input Initial Investment: Enter the quantity you prepare to buy SCHD.

Choose a Holding Period: Decide for how long you prepare to hold onto the investment (1 year, 5 years, 10 years, and so on).

Select Dividend Growth Rate: Estimate the typical growth rate of dividends. A typical estimate is in between 4-7% based on historic performance.

Choose on Reinvestment: Indicate whether you plan to reinvest dividends or take them as cash.

Calculate Results: Click on the estimation button to view the results, which will typically include total returns and ending balance.
